Very Clever Baby / Freddy the Fish
From an interview with Garth Nix in the July 2000 issue of The Internet Writing Journal:
They [The Very Clever Baby Books] are little books that I first made back in 1988 as presents for some friends expecting babies, on the basis that all parents think their babies are geniuses. Each one is only 12 pages long and about the same size as a greeting card. Basically, they feature a character called Freddy the Fish and are supposed to be for "Very Clever Babies Aged 3-6 Months". Since no babies that age can read and the books have very big words like 'Ichthyologist' and 'Tetradontidae' it is surprising that some people don't get the joke. There are three at present, Very Clever Baby's First Reader, Very Clever Baby's Ben*Hur and Very Clever Baby's First Christmas. They are only published in Australia, by {{Publisher|Text Publishing}}, but I hope to find an American publisher with a suitable sense of humor one of these days.
Titles (4)
| # | Title | Author(s) | Year | Type |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Very Clever Baby's First Reader: A Simple Reader for Your Child Featuring Freddy the Fish and Easy Words | Garth Nix | 1988 | Nonfiction |
| 2 | Very Clever Baby's Ben Hur: Starring Freddy the Fish As Charlton Heston | Garth Nix | 1988 | Nonfiction |
| 3 | Very Clever Baby's Guide to the Greenhouse Effect | Garth Nix | 1992 | Nonfiction |
| 4 | Very Clever Baby's First Christmas | Garth Nix | 1998 | Nonfiction |
